Schedule Dedicated "Course Time"
The Official SAT Online Course is like any other learning tool: The more time students spend with the course, the more they will benefit from it.
While the flexibility of the course ensures that every school can implement the program in its own unique way, the following tip represents one example of how teachers can help guarantee that all students enjoy regular access to the course.
Set aside dedicated "course time" during regular school hours when students can use school computers to access the course. Students can use this time to work on specific assignments, or to pursue independent study.
At Deep Run High School in Glen Allen, Virginia, where all students have their own laptop computers, English teacher Connie Fuller regularly assigns practice essays as a classroom activity. In schools with only a handful of classroom computers, students should take turns accessing the course, ensuring that everyone gets a chance to do so during school hours. If a computer lab is available, schedule time at regular intervals when the entire class can go to the lab and access the course.
The key lies in guaranteeing all students regular access to the course, whatever computer resources happen to be available.

Can educators generate student access codes within the online course?
A student needs an access code to register for the online course. If a student does not have an access code, you may generate one from within the online course:
 | Go to the Class Management tab. |
 | Click on the Manage Student Access Codes link. |
 | Enter the number of access codes you wish to generate and click Generate. |
 | You will see the newly created student codes listed. |
